Output 31fbe74d0665396095a3c3c27cbb669f769d8295b164d29752e6e5398fd76b80:5

value
387785
script pubkey
OP_0 OP_PUSHBYTES_20 8aacab1c665115802af56c22c19a03ee9d90ca8b
address
bc1q32k2k8rx2y2cq2h4ds3vrxsra6wepj5ta2v858
transaction
31fbe74d0665396095a3c3c27cbb669f769d8295b164d29752e6e5398fd76b80
spent
true